HCAR1 (hydroxycarboxylic acid receptor 1), also known as GPR81, is a G protein-coupled receptor (GPCR) primarily expressed in adipose tissue, liver, and the central nervous system. It plays a key role in metabolic regulation by binding to endogenous ligands, such as lactate, thereby modulating lipolysis and energy homeostasis. Activation of HCAR1 has been associated with anti-inflammatory effects, insulin sensitivity, and potential therapeutic applications in metabolic disorders, including obesity and type 2 diabetes. Due to its physiological significance, HCAR1 has become a target for drug development and biomedical research.

Human HCAR1 virus-like particles (VLPs) are non-infectious nanostructures designed to mimic the membrane-bound form of the native HCAR1 receptor but lack viral genetic material. These VLPs are typically produced by expressing HCAR1 and viral structural proteins, such as envelope or capsid proteins, in recombinant systems, such as mammalian, insect, or yeast cells. The self-assembly properties of VLPs ensure proper folding and post-translational modification of HCAR1, making them excellent tools for studying receptor-ligand interactions, antibody development, and vaccine design. HCAR1 VLPs offer advantages over traditional soluble receptors because they preserve the native conformation and membrane environment of HCAR1, enabling more accurate biochemical and immunological studies. Furthermore, they hold promise as delivery vehicles for targeted therapies or as immunogens for generating HCAR1-specific antibodies for diagnostic and therapeutic applications.

What is HCAR1?

A: HCAR1 (Hydroxycarboxylic Acid Receptor 1) is a Protein Coding gene. Diseases associated with HCAR1 include Pellagra and Diversion Colitis. Among its related pathways are GPCR downstream signalling and Class A/1 (Rhodopsin-like receptors). Gene Ontology (GO) annotations related to this gene include G protein-coupled receptor activity. An important paralog of this gene is HCAR2.
